提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档
文章目录
目标
- 掌握循环语句,让程序具备重复执行能力
- 掌握数组声明及访问的语法
内容
3.1 循环-for
3.1.1 for循环基本使用
3.1.1-a for
循环语法
也是重复执行的代码
好处:把声明起始值、循环条件、变化值写到一起,让人一目了然
<script>
for (声明记录循环次数的变量; 循环条件; 变化值) {
循环体
}
</script>
3.1.1-b for循环流程图
3.1.1-c for循环和while
循环在使用上面不同的应用场景
已知循环的次数
的时候推荐使用for
循环
未知确循环的次数
的时候推荐使用while
循环
3.1.2 循环中断
3.1.2-a 循环退出:
正常退出:当条件表达式不满足
意外退出: continue
,break
一般是在循环语句里面使用 使用的时候 一般会配合 if
语句
3.1.3-b 循环中断 :
continue
:在循环体里面当遇到 continue
关键字中断
本次循环 然后继续执行下一次循环
break
:在循环里面当遇到 break
关键字会将整个
循环结束
3.1.3 循环嵌套
for循环嵌套
<script>
for (声明外部记录循环次数的变量; 循环条件; 变化值) {
for (声明内部记录循环次数的变量; 循环条件; 变化值) {
循环体
}
}
//一个循环里再套一个循环,一般用在for循环里
</script>
3.2 数组
3.2.1 数组是什么
数组(Array)
是一种可以按顺序保存数据的数据类型
3.2.2 数组的基本使用
3.2.2-a 声明语法
<script>
let names = ['小米','小明','小红','小刚','张三']
let 数组名 = [数据1,数据2,